Spicy Cauliflower Rice With Ground Turkey

Spicy Cauliflower Rice With Ground Turkey for a Quick Dinner

Enjoy a quick and flavorful Spicy Cauliflower Rice With Ground Turkey, perfect for weeknight dinners and healthy meal prep.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Healthy
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Rice
  • 1 head Cauliflower Cut into small rice-sized pieces
  • 1 pound Ground Turkey Lean protein option
For the Spice Mix
  • 1 tablespoon Chili Powder Adjust for preferred spice level
  • 1 teaspoon Cumin Adds depth to the flavor
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der For enhanced flavor
For the Vegetables
  • 2 cups Bell Peppers Chopped; mix different colors
  • 1 medium Onion Chopped; yellow or red
For Cooking
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il For sautéing; can substitute with coconut oil
  • Salt and Pepper To taste

Equipment

  • large skillet

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ions
  1. Begin by preparing your ingredients. Cut the cauliflower into rice-sized pieces and chop the bell peppers and onion.
  2.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the ground turkey and cook for about 5-7 minutes until browned.
  3. Stir in the chopped onions and bell peppers, then sprinkle in the chili powder, cumin, and garlic powder.
  4. Once the turkey is cooked, add the cauliflower rice and stir to combine all ingredients. Cook for another 5 minutes.
  5. Taste the dish and adjust seasoning as necessary, adding salt, pepper, or lime juice before serving.
